Michael Chavis Optioned To Triple-A

Boston Red Sox second baseman Michael Chavis has been optioned to Triple-A Worcester. It seems this move will correspond with Christian Arroyo's return from the injured list. Chavis has performed decently well in limited time this season, with a .273/.273/.485 slash line through 33 at-bats, but there's no need to hold him on fantasy rosters.
